openeuler 连 oracle 11g怎么配置
时间: 2024-02-07 16:00:58 浏览: 116
要在openeuler上配置Oracle 11g,需按照以下步骤进行:
1. 首先,确保系统满足Oracle 11g的要求。检查系统内核版本、内存和硬盘空间以及其他系统要求是否符合Oracle 11g的要求。
2. 下载并安装Oracle 11g软件包。请确保选择适用于openeuler的版本,并按照Oracle的安装指南进行安装。
3. 在安装过程中,您需要选择安装类型。这里选择“典型安装”将会为您配置一个基本的Oracle 11g环境。
4. 在安装过程中,您需要为Oracle 11g设置密码,并选择要安装的组件。根据您的需求选择所需的组件。
5. 安装完成后,需要手动进行一些配置。首先,编辑ORACLE_HOME目录下的环境变量文件,将ORACLE_HOME和PATH设置为正确的值。
6. 接下来,您需要初始化Oracle实例。使用dbca命令创建并配置数据库实例。根据您的需求设置数据库名称、字符集等。
7. 配置监听器。编辑监听器配置文件,并启动监听器以侦听数据库连接请求。
8. 配置客户端连接。编辑tnsnames.ora文件,并添加数据库连接信息。
9. 最后,启动Oracle数据库,并进行一些测试以确保一切正常。您可以尝试使用SQL*Plus或其他工具连接到数据库,并执行一些简单的SQL命令来验证安装和配置是否成功。
需要注意的是,这只是一个基本的配置过程。实际上,根据您的具体需求,还可能需要进行一些额外的配置和调整。建议您参考Oracle官方文档或寻求专业人士的帮助以确保正确配置Oracle 11g。
相关问题
openeuler安装oracle11g
OpenEuler是一款基于Linux的操作系统,主要用于服务器和高性能计算环境。虽然OpenEuler提供了丰富的软件包管理系统,如YUM或Apt,但Oracle数据库(包括11g版本)通常不直接在官方仓库中提供预编译的包。因此,要在OpenEuler上安装Oracle 11g,你需要手动下载安装介质、编译或使用社区维护的RPM包。
以下是安装Oracle 11g的基本步骤,但请注意这是一项复杂的任务,需要专业的数据库管理知识:
1. **获取安装文件**:访问Oracle官网(https://www.oracle.com/database/technologies/server-storage-software-downloads.html)下载Oracle Database 11g的安装文件,通常选择对应OpenEuler版本的Linux二进制安装程序。
2. **创建一个新的安装目录**:在OpenEuler上创建一个目录用于安装,例如`/opt/oracle`。
3. **安装前的准备**:
- 检查硬件需求,确保满足Oracle数据库的最低要求。
- 配置必要的环境变量,如PATH和LD_LIBRARY_PATH。
- 可能需要关闭防火墙和SELinux以允许数据库安装。
4. **执行安装**:
- 使用管理员权限运行安装脚本,如`chmod +x filename.sh`,然后`./filename.sh`。
- 遵循安装向导的提示,可能需要进行许可协议确认,配置网络,选择安装类型(典型或定制)等。
5. **创建数据库实例**:安装完成后,需要运行一些命令行工具(如`sqlplus`或`lsnrctl`)来创建数据库实例、监听器和其他配置。
6. **初始化和配置数据库**:使用Oracle提供的工具(如`oraInst.loc`或`runInstaller`)进行初始化和数据文件创建。
7. **启动服务**:配置完成后,可以启动数据库服务和监听器。
由于这个过程涉及到多个步骤和配置,强烈建议查阅Oracle官方文档(https://docs.oracle.com/cd/E11882_01/server.112/e10592/install.htm),以及针对OpenEuler特定调整的教程来完成安装。
**相关问题--:**
1. 如何检查OpenEuler的硬件兼容性?
2. 怎么在OpenEuler上设置环境变量?
3. 安装过程中如何处理Oracle的许可协议?
在openeuler安装oracle数据库
以下是在openEuler上安装Oracle数据库的步骤:
1. 下载Oracle数据库的安装包。可以从Oracle官网下载,需要注册账号并同意许可协议。
2. 安装必要的软件包,如gcc、libaio1、libaio-devel等。可以使用以下命令安装:
```
sudo dnf install gcc libaio1 libaio-devel
```
3. 创建一个Oracle用户和组。可以使用以下命令创建:
```
sudo groupadd oinstall
sudo groupadd dba
sudo useradd -g oinstall -G dba oracle
```
4. 修改系统内核参数。可以使用以下命令进行修改:
```
sudo vi /etc/sysctl.conf
```
在文件中添加以下内容:
```
fs.file-max = 6815744
kernel.sem = 250 32000 100 128
kernel.shmmni = 4096
kernel.shmall = 1073741824
kernel.shmmax = 4398046511104
net.ipv4.ip_local_port_range = 9000 65500
net.core.rmem_default = 262144
net.core.rmem_max = 4194304
net.core.wmem_default = 262144
net.core.wmem_max = 1048576
```
保存文件并执行以下命令使修改生效:
```
sudo sysctl -p
```
5. 创建Oracle安装目录并设置权限。可以使用以下命令创建:
```
sudo mkdir -p /u01/app/oracle/product/11.2.0/dbhome_1
sudo chown -R oracle:oinstall /u01
sudo chmod -R 775 /u01
```
6. 解压Oracle安装包并运行安装程序。可以使用以下命令进行解压:
```
unzip linux.x64_11gR2_database_1of2.zip
unzip linux.x64_11gR2_database_2of2.zip
```
然后切换到解压后的目录并执行安装程序:
```
./runInstaller
```
按照安装向导进行安装。在安装过程中,需要选择安装类型、安装目录、数据库名称、管理员账号等。
7. 安装完成后,需要执行一些后续配置。可以使用以下命令进行配置:
```
sudo vi /etc/oratab
```
在文件中添加以下内容:
```
orcl:/u01/app/oracle/product/11.2.0/dbhome_1:Y
```
保存文件后,执行以下命令启动数据库:
```
sudo su - oracle
sqlplus / as sysdba
startup
```
至此,在openEuler上安装Oracle数据库的步骤就完成了。
阅读全文